ho|me|o|sta|sis «HOH mee uh STAY sihs, HOM ee-», noun.
Physiology. the tendency of an organism to maintain internal equilibrium, as of temperature and fluid content, by the regulation of its bodily processes.
[< Greek hómoios like + stásis position]
